Alcorn State Hires Eugenia Fernandez as Head Coach

Alcorn State has hired Eugenia Fernandez as the program’s new head coach.

The position had been open since May 31st, when previous head coach Josef Rankin was non-renewed in his role. The Lady Braves went through the entirety of the summer and majority of the fall with an interim head coach.

Fernandez previously spent a stint on staff at Florida A&M, most recently as a volunteer assistant coach. She was also an assistant coach on the program’s staff in 2014 and 2015. She was part of the coaching staff that helped guide the Rattlers to back-to-back NCAA tournament appearances in each of those years.

Prior to her college coaching tenures, Fernandez spent more than a decade playing for the Colombian national team. A native of Colombia, Fernandez played for the national program in various tournaments including the Pan Am Games and World Championships over her time in the uniform. She played collegiately at Miami Dade College, earning all-conference honors twice.

At Alcorn, Fernandez takes over a program that finished 17-33 overall last season with a 9-12 showing against SWAC opponents in conference play.
